Whispering Oaks Horse Ranch offers guided horseback riding on Yuma Lane in Temecula, operating as the kind of facility where beginners and casual riders make up the steady clientele rather than competitive equestrians. Rides range from short trail loops to longer outings, typically accommodating groups of varying experience levels and families introducing kids to horses for the first time. The typical visitor is a local planning a weekend outing, a family looking for something different than a standard park day, or a visitor from out of area wanting a guided experience without owning a horse or prior trail experience. Summer can draw day-trippers from inland areas seeking cooler rides in the Temecula foothills; spring and fall tend toward steadier regular bookings. Walking-pace rides dominate the schedule; seasoned riders accustomed to faster gaits or technical terrain elsewhere in the backcountry will find a different kind of operation than what the ranch typically offers.

Winter White Barn operates an equestrian facility on Vía Del Oso in Temecula, offering trail rides and lessons for riders ranging from first-time visitors to experienced horseback enthusiasts. The operation suits families looking for a structured weekend activity, beginner riders wanting instruction before hitting longer regional trails, and intermediate riders maintaining their skills between backcountry outings in the Santa Rosa Plateau or Cleveland National Forest. The facility draws casual day-trippers and local residents who already know their way around a horse, as well as organized groups and birthday parties seeking a half-day outing. No prior experience is a barrier to entry, though comfort with animals and basic fitness help. Seasonality follows the region's heat cycle — fall through early spring sees the steadiest flow, while summer rides happen but demand more heat tolerance. For riders looking to explore longer wilderness routes or multi-day pack trips, the outfit gives a foundation; for anyone wanting a calm, guided introduction to horseback activity without leaving Temecula proper, this is the direct option.

Cross Creek Golf Club on Glen Meadows Road carries golf and resort apparel — polo shirts, performance shorts, outerwear, and accessories built around the sport and its lifestyle rather than general fashion. The merchandise skews practical and brand-focused, the kind of curated selection where most inventory serves an actual purpose on or off the course rather than a broad wardrobe spectrum. This suits golfers outfitting themselves for play, members needing a replacement polo or belt between rounds, and casual shoppers looking for resort-wear without hunting through a department store. The experience is straightforward retail without heavy styling intervention — browse the racks, find your size, move on. For everyday clothing or fashion-forward pieces, the boutiques and stores in Old Town Temecula or the Promenade Mall offer wider ranges. For golf-specific gear and apparel where function and course culture drive the selection, Cross Creek fills that narrower, sport-specific lane.
